Raising a family in Washington, DC is a wonderful experience.
The city offers strong public transit, world-class museums, walkable neighborhoods, and family-friendly spaces like parks, pools, and playgrounds.
Aidan Montessori is located in Woodley Park, a neighborhood in Northwest DC, close to the Smithsonian National Zoological Park, a Red Line Metro stop, Rock Creek Park, and a wide range of restaurants serving global cuisine.

Neighborhoods & Commuting
Aidan families are both long-time DC residents and new arrivals. While every neighborhood in the city has something special to offer, many Aidan families call these places home:
- Woodley Park
- Adams Morgan
- Columbia Heights/Mt. Pleasant
- Cleveland Park
- Van Ness
- Tenleytown
- Spring Valley
- Chevy Chase DC
Many families also commute from Maryland, Virginia, and all corners of DC.
